Pros

  • Pulverizes tough ingredients (raspberry pips, kale, ginger) to completely smooth consistency
  • Wide attachment ecosystem (48oz container, stainless steel, aer container, food processor)
  • Simple, intuitive operation per long-term user
  • Effective for nutrition-dense preparations (smoothies, fibrous vegetables)
  • Durable enough for long-term satisfaction (reviewed at 2-year mark)

Cons

  • Extremely expensive — requires significant financial deliberation or financing
  • Must run multiple blend cycles for absolute certainty on toughest ingredients
  • High cost of entry for additional containers and attachments

Video Reality (3 YouTube videos)

YouTube video data reveals strong user satisfaction from long-term owners. A commenter on Blending For Good (207K views) reports the A3500 completely pulverizes raspberry pips and fibrous kale to a smooth consistency, critical for a family member with a medical condition requiring completely smooth nutrition delivery. The user runs 2-4 smoothie cycles for certainty. Another owner on the A3500 vs X Series comparison video (36K views) expresses love for the machine and highlights extensive attachment compatibility: 48oz container, stainless steel container, aer container, and food processor attachment — all described as highly functional. This user specifically notes the A3500 is simple to use. Both comments come from users who deliberated extensively before purchase due to the high cost, with one financing via interest-free credit. The channel itself (Blending For Good, 59.9K subs) is a dedicated blending channel that appears commercially affiliated with Vitamix.
